West Ham United boss David Moyes has said that his team will enter Saturday's clash with Stoke City full of confidence after two impressive results.

The Hammers have beaten Chelsea and drawn with Arsenal in their last two Premier League matches, and will now visit the bet365 Stadium looking to build on their recent improvement.

The capital club are still down in 19th position in the Premier League table after a tough start to the campaign, however, and Moyes has insisted that his side still have a lot of work to do in the coming months.

"Anybody who beats Chelsea and anybody who gets a result against Arsenal, especially in the position we are in would see it as a real positive," Moyes told reporters.

"We have still got to climb the table, so we still have to win an awful lot more games. We can pat ourselves on the back for the performances and how well the players have done. But overall, we still have a lot of games to go and we have got to win them."

West Ham are yet to record an away win in the Premier League this season.
